Frozen Pineapple Margaritas

Frozen Pineapple Margaritas are a tropical, sweet, and tangy drink with a kick of heat from jalapeño. Sweetened with a touch of agave, this Margarita recipe features frozen chunks of sweet pineapple, tequila, triple sec, and freshly squeezed lime juice with a contrasting spicy-salty rim. A perfectly refreshing, sweet and tangy, slightly spicy cocktail!

Servings: 2 Margaritas
Calories: 247kcal

Ingredients

Ingredients for the Cocktail:

  • 1 cup ice
  • 2 cups frozen pineapple chunks
  • ½ - 1 fresh jalapeno
  • 2 Tablespoons lime juice
  • 2 teaspoons agave nectar
  • ¼ tequila
  • 3 Tablespoons triple sec

Optional Ingredients for the Garnish:

  • cayenne pepper
  • salt
  • lime slices

Instructions

  • Place all the ingredients for the margarita into a blender. Blenduntil smooth.
  • For the rim, combine salt and cayenne pepper on a small
  • plate. Run a lime wedge along the edge of each glass and dip
  • it into the cayenne salt mixture to coat.
  • Garnish with fresh slices of lime and enjoy.

Notes

If you're looking to make a frozen margarita mocktail, substitute the tequila and triple sec in the recipe for some pineapple juice. This will make for a delicious non-alcoholic version of this margarita that is still full of flavor and fun!
